"Brass Surveyor's Square In Its Walnut Case - Signed "a Berthelemy Paris" 19th Century"
Antique solid brass surveying instrument with prismatic readings, signed Bathelemy, Paris, dating from the second half of the 19th century (circa 1860-1870). This magnetic instrument was used by surveyors and engineers for land surveys, determining directions, and orienting plans. It is presented with its original wooden case, fitted with brass handles. Good overall original condition with a beautiful antique patina - a fine collector's item.
